- Abstract: Flavonols are polyphenolic compounds with diverse pharmacological and biological activities. In this work, a general method for large‐scale synthesis of these biologically important compounds, using available substrates, is reported. The reaction was occurred via Michael‐dehydrogenative reaction using green, inexpensive and highly efficient heterogeneous cobalt catalysts without any ligands and/or additives, the activity of CoFe2 O4 and Co‐NPs was studied and compared. These procedures have advantages such as lack of hazardous oxidants, simplicity of work‐up, eco‐friendly of reaction medium, mild reaction conditions and high yield of products. In addition, the binding modes of synthesized compounds to estrogen receptor (ER) was studied by molecular docking and good results was obtained.
